Hierarchical paging method
Most modern computer systems maintain a large logical-address space. In this situation the page table itself turns into excessively large. To remedy this memory wastage we won't allocate the page table contiguously in main memory.
One way is to utilize two-level paging algorithm, in which page table is as well paged. A logical address is separated into a page number consisting of 20 bits and a page offset consisting of 12 bits. for the reason that we page the page table, the page number is additional divided into a 10-bit page number and a 10 bit page offset. At this point address translation works as of the outer page table inwards this scheme is called as forward-mapped page table.
